Subject: Quickstore 4.2 — bloom filter now fronts the KV layer

Plugin authors: starting with this release, Quickstore places a bloom filter ahead of the key-value store. Negative lookups return faster; false positives fall through safely. No API changes are required on your side. Verify your plugin against the staging build referenced below.

session token of fahif-tadup = htk3_9c7

### Runbook: Pagination checks — Bramblehook Public API

Quick sanity pass before approving pagination changes: cursors must be opaque, stable under inserts, and survive a page-size change mid-walk. Hit /v2/listings with limit=2 and walk at least five pages; duplicates or gaps mean the keyset index regressed. To compare results against raw rows, query the staging database directly using the connection string below.

primary connection of tajeg-tajop = postgresql://julax_svc:DI@db-e7f3.kelvidyn.corp:5432/rusdor

// Context for on-call: we're hunting leaked file descriptors in the
// Copperline ingest workers. This client connects to the Fdscope
// telemetry service so we can sample per-process descriptor counts
// every 30 seconds. Keep the polling interval conservative — Fdscope
// rate-limits aggressively and a ban would blind us mid-incident.
// The client authenticates with a scoped read-only key, which is
// defined on the next line.

API key for yahig-tadup: kto7_ubizbYm

## Break-Glass: Dedup Pipeline (Mergewell)

Hey release folks — if the Mergewell dedup job starts collapsing distinct customer records again, you can break glass and halt the merge queue directly. Flip the pipeline to read-only, snapshot the survivorship table, and only then unlock the override console. Don't skip the snapshot; undoing a bad merge without it is miserable. The override console will prompt before it does anything destructive. Use the recovery passphrase below to open it.

unlock words, yawig-kagef: gordor-holvan-ulaael-pramir-ulaiel-tamdor